Happy NEW Year to all of my blog friends and family! 
My prayer for you this NEW Year-
That God will fill your heart (and mouth) with a NEW song
Psalm 40:3
And He has put a new song in my mouth, a song of praise to our God. Many shall see and fear (revere and worship) and put their trust and confident reliance in the Lord.
That every day you will see NEW reasons to praise God
Psalm 145:2
Every day [with its new reasons] will I bless You [affectionately and gratefully praise You]; yes, I will praise Your name forever and ever.
That you will experience great NEW things in God
Isaiah 42:9
Behold, the former things have come to pass, and new things I now declare; before they spring forth I tell you of them.
Isaiah 43:19
Behold, I am doing a new thing! Now it springs forth; do you not perceive and know it and will you not give heed to it? I will even make a way in the wilderness and rivers in the desert.
That you will see fulfillment of the NEW things God has promised you
Isaiah 48:6
You have heard [these things foretold], now you see this fulfillment. And will you not bear witness to it? I show you specified new things from this time forth, even hidden things [kept in reserve] which you have not known.
That you will live in NEWness of life
Romans 6:4
We were buried therefore with Him by the baptism into death, so that just as Christ was raised from the dead by the glorious [power] of the Father, so we too might [habitually] live and behave in newness of life.
Romans 6:5
For if we have become one with Him by sharing a death like His, we shall also be [one with Him in sharing] His resurrection [by a new life lived for God].
That you will believe and live like the NEW creation that you are
2 Corinthians 5:17
Therefore if any person is [ingrafted] in Christ (the Messiah) he is a new creation (a new creature altogether); the old [previous moral and spiritual condition] has passed away. Behold, the fresh and new has come!
That you will hear and believe Jesus speaking these words over you-
Revelation 21:5
And He Who is seated on the throne said, See! I make all things new.
